Irida’s Giraffe Museum is free to tour and is open Thursday through Saturday from 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. The museum is a house that was turned into a museum by a local resident. There are over 1,300 Giraffe figurines from all around the world.

Not quite Mesa, but close enough to count, Usery Mountain Park is 3,648 acres of hiking trails, volcanic tuff, and hanging gardens set against the Goldfield Mountain Range. Here in the Wind Cave Trail, you can feel the water seeping from the roof down onto the hanging gardens called Rock Daisy.
